SCHEDULE: Vanguard Group Amends Amerant Bancorp Ownership to 0%
Beneficial Ownership Amendment
The Vanguard Group has filed an amended Schedule 13G, reporting 0% beneficial ownership in Amerant Bancorp Inc. following an internal realignment.
Summary
- The Vanguard Group filed an Amendment No. 1 to Schedule 13G for Amerant Bancorp Inc. Common Stock.
- The filing reports 0% beneficial ownership of Amerant Bancorp Inc. Common Stock by The Vanguard Group.
- This change is a result of an internal realignment within The Vanguard Group, Inc. that occurred on January 12, 2026.
- Following the realignment, certain subsidiaries or business divisions of The Vanguard Group, Inc. will now report beneficial ownership separately (on a disaggregated basis) in reliance on SEC Release No. 34-39538.
- The Vanguard Group, Inc. no longer has, or is deemed to have, beneficial ownership over securities beneficially owned by these subsidiaries and/or business divisions.

Industry Context
StockSavvy.ai notes that large asset managers like The Vanguard Group frequently undergo internal restructurings or realignments that necessitate updates to their beneficial ownership filings. Disaggregated reporting, as described in SEC Release No. 34-39538, is a standard practice for complex investment organizations to ensure accurate and compliant disclosure of holdings across various funds and divisions.
